Krispy Kreme Inc (NASDAQ:DNUT) Stock Surges on Strong Profit Beat and Turnaround Progress

Krispy Kreme Inc (NASDAQ:DNUT) reported financial results for the fourth quarter and full year 2025, delivering a mixed performance that was ultimately cheered by investors. The company's quarterly figures surpassed analyst expectations on profitability, while a strategic contraction in its store footprint led to a slight revenue miss. The market's positive reaction, with shares rising significantly in pre-market trading, suggests investors are focusing on the company's improving margins and the tangible progress of its multi-year turnaround plan.

Quarterly Performance Versus Estimates

The doughnut chain's fourth-quarter results presented a clear dichotomy between top-line contraction and bottom-line expansion. Revenue for the quarter came in at $392.4 million, a 2.9% decline compared to the same period last year. This figure narrowly missed the analyst consensus estimate of approximately $394.4 million.

However, the company's profitability metrics told a more compelling story. Krispy Kreme reported ad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of $0.09, which was a substantial beat compared to the $0.03 analysts had anticipated. This performance also marked a significant improvement from the $0.01 adjusted EPS reported in the fourth quarter of 2024.

The divergence between revenue and profit trends is a direct result of management's ongoing strategic overhaul. The company is actively closing underperforming locations—referred to as "doors"—to enhance overall profitability, a move that sacrifices some sales volume for better margins.

Market Reaction and Strategic Context

The immediate market response was decisively positive, with the stock jumping approximately 12% in pre-market trading following the earnings release. This bullish move indicates that investors are prioritizing the company's operational improvements and future guidance over the modest quarterly revenue decline.

The positive sentiment is likely fueled by several key takeaways from the report:

  • Margin Expansion: Adjusted EBITDA margin expanded by 280 basis points year-over-year to 14.2%, driven by productivity initiatives, cost savings, and the strategic closure of unprofitable locations.
  • Positive Cash Flow: The company generated $27.9 million in free cash flow during the quarter, a critical milestone for a business focused on deleveraging its balance sheet.
  • Turnaround Plan Execution: CEO Josh Charlesworth stated the company demonstrated "meaningful progress on our turnaround," specifically highlighting profitable U.S. expansion and capital-light international franchise growth.

Full-Year Results and Forward Outlook

For the full fiscal year 2025, the financial picture reflects the significant one-time impacts of the company's strategic shifts. Revenue declined 8.6% to $1.52 billion, heavily influenced by the sale of a majority stake in Insomnia Cookies and the termination of the partnership with McDonald's USA. The company reported a substantial GAAP net loss of $523.8 million, largely due to a $432.4 million goodwill and asset impairment charge.

Looking ahead, management provided financial guidance for 2026 that sets a course for measured, profitable growth. The outlook includes:

  • Systemwide sales growth of 2% to 4% in constant currency.
  • Capital expenditures significantly reduced to a range of $50 to $60 million.
  • A commitment to generating positive free cash flow.
  • A target to lower the net leverage ratio to at or below 5.5x.

This guidance, particularly the reduced capital spending and focus on cash flow, aligns with the core pillars of the turnaround plan: refranchising international markets, improving returns on invested capital, expanding margins, and driving sustainable, profitable growth.

Conclusion

Krispy Kreme's latest earnings report underscores a company in the midst of a deliberate transformation. While revenue growth remains elusive as the business sheds underperforming assets, the foundational elements of a healthier enterprise are emerging. Sharply improved profitability metrics, a return to positive cash flow, and a disciplined outlook for the year ahead have given investors confidence that the turnaround strategy is gaining traction. The market's reaction suggests a belief that the company is trading short-term sales for long-term financial stability and shareholder value.
